26 /**
27  * DOC: TX A-MPDU aggregation
28  *
29  * Aggregation on the TX side requires setting the hardware flag
30  * %IEEE80211_HW_AMPDU_AGGREGATION. The driver will then be handed
31  * packets with a flag indicating A-MPDU aggregation. The driver
32  * or device is responsible for actually aggregating the frames,
33  * as well as deciding how many and which to aggregate.
34  *
35  * When TX aggregation is started by some subsystem (usually the rate
36  * control algorithm would be appropriate) by calling the
37  * ieee80211_start_tx_ba_session() function, the driver will be
38  * notified via its @ampdu_action function, with the
39  * %IEEE80211_AMPDU_TX_START action.
40  *
41  * In response to that, the driver is later required to call the
42  * ieee80211_start_tx_ba_cb_irqsafe() function, which will really
43  * start the aggregation session after the peer has also responded.
44  * If the peer responds negatively, the session will be stopped
45  * again right away. Note that it is possible for the aggregation
46  * session to be stopped before the driver has indicated that it
47  * is done setting it up, in which case it must not indicate the
48  * setup completion.
49  *
50  * Also note that, since we also need to wait for a response from
51  * the peer, the driver is notified of the completion of the
52  * handshake by the %IEEE80211_AMPDU_TX_OPERATIONAL action to the
53  * @ampdu_action callback.
54  *
55  * Similarly, when the aggregation session is stopped by the peer
56  * or something calling ieee80211_stop_tx_ba_session(), the driver's
57  * @ampdu_action function will be called with the action
58  * %IEEE80211_AMPDU_TX_STOP. In this case, the call must not fail,
59  * and the driver must later call ieee80211_stop_tx_ba_cb_irqsafe().
60  * Note that the sta can get destroyed before the BA tear down is
61  * complete.
62  */
